Quick Summary

This Special Notice announces a subcontract opportunity for a digital solution to modernize receiving processes at the Frederick National Laboratory for Cancer Research (FNLCR). Leidos Biomedical Research, Inc. (Leidos Biomed), the FNLCR operator for the National Cancer Institute (NCI), is seeking proposals under RFP No. S26-117 for a "Receiving Process Improvement and Digital Transformation" project. The FNLCR is a Government-Owned Contractor-Operated Federally Funded Research and Development Center (FFRDC).

Scope of Work

Leidos Biomed seeks a digital solution to enhance process efficiency at the FNLCR Materials Management receiving dock and internal delivery operations. The scope includes:

  • Assessment and review of current receiving processes.
  • Design, planning, installation, and configuration of software solutions to meet FNL/Leidos Biomed’s use cases and business requirements.
  • End-user, system administrator, and system owner training.
  • Go-Live and operational support services. Objectives include minimizing delivery errors, staging congestion, and dock backlogs, while improving transparency, accountability, productivity, and efficiency in materials receipt, internal delivery, and return processing.

Key Requirements / Deliverables

The desired solution is a state-of-the-art enterprise-level system featuring mobile barcode scanning, label printing, digital driver delivery queue tracking, digital signatures, and real-time status visibility. Key deliverables include a Project Plan, Meeting Minutes, Bi-weekly Status Reports, Technical/Solution deliverables (e.g., Requirements Traceability Matrix, Configuration/Design Document, Architecture Blueprints), UAT Test Plan and Scripts, Proof of Concept demonstration, fully configured environments, Final Test Report, Training Plan and Schedule, and a Final Report.

Contract Details

  • Contract Type: Firm-Fixed-Price.
  • Set-Aside: Small business subcontracting opportunities are to be maximized.
  • Eligibility: Offerors must be registered with the System for Award Management (SAM). Specific certifications are required, including Organizational Conflicts of Interest (OCI) and Limitations on Pass-Through Charges.

Submission & Evaluation

  • Questions Due: February 12, 2026, by 4 PM EST.
  • Offers Due: March 5, 2026, by 4 PM EST.
  • Submission Method: Electronic submission in searchable Adobe Acrobat, Microsoft Word, or Microsoft Excel formats (files not exceeding 15 MB).
  • Contact: Cody Wenner at cody.wenner@nih.gov for a copy of Solicitation/RFP No: S26-117 and for questions.
  • Evaluation Factors: Technical Approach (40%), Team and Key Personnel (25%), Experience and Past Performance (10%), Project Plan and Work Breakdown Structure (10%), Management (5%), and Cost Reasonableness (10%). Offers must be valid for 120 days.
